We investigate the bright-to-dark exciton conversion efficiency in type-II quantum dots subject to a
perpendicular magnetic field. To this end, we take the exciton storage protocol recently proposed
by Simonin and co-workers [Phys. Rev. B 89, 075304 (2014)] and simulate its coherent dynamics.
We confirm the storage is efficient in perfectly circular structures subject to weak external electric
fields, where adiabatic evolution is dominant. In practice, however, the efficiency rapidly degrades
with symmetry lowering. Besides, the use of excited states is likely unfeasible owing to the fast
decay rates. We then propose an adaptation of the protocol which does not suffer from these
limitations [-]
